Transaction 126bc1def061febedf0aca4072c243b7009338c56c41287257fee8114ea420ca

38 Input
2 Outputs
  • 126bc1def061febedf0aca4072c243b7009338c56c41287257fee8114ea420ca:0
  • value  17169
    address  1wM48uuTqW885zRJvWuCfCKTD2TBMuAER
  • 126bc1def061febedf0aca4072c243b7009338c56c41287257fee8114ea420ca:1
  • value  74000000
    address  3AmaFobND3H7fLGKx8VZsTAwxEeEWJjwAU